Do you have favorite T-shirts tucked away in drawers or packed in a closet because they're too meaningful to part with? Turn those treasured memories into a beautiful keepsake! In this class, you'll learn the basics of creating a T-shirt quilt that lets you preserve your favorite moments while making something you can enjoy for years to come. Students are responsible for bringing all required materials. Class Duration: 2.5 hours each class Age Requirements: Adult 18 and up Recommended Prerequisite: Sewing - Introduction to the Sewing Machine. All attendees are required to know how to sew. Required Skills: Someone who can sew straight and curved seams while keeping a consistent seam allowance, can thread a standard machine and wind a bobbin, has a basic understanding of different fabric types and has completed several projects. Materials Fee: None Out of District Fee: $10 (includes class and materials fees) Materials: Students are responsible for bringing all required materials. 2 1/2 to 3 yards of fabric for backing, this can be purchased after the first class. 3 yards of lightweight interfacing: Pellon SF101 Shape-Flex or T-shirt Stabilizer Ask store representative for other options. Bring 12 prewashed adult size large logo t-shirts for best results. Note: All t-shirt logos will be cut down to 12 ½” squares during class. Avoid pre cutting. Batting estimated 2 1/2 to 3 yards. This can be purchased after the frist class. Note: Sewing skills are necessary to be successful in this class. New to sewing? Take Introduction to the Sewing Machine prior to attending this class.
